Cuyahoga County Options For Independent Living | Cuyahoga County Division Of Senior And Adult Services

Provides case management and coordination of needed home care services in the following areas: medical transportation, emergency response system, personal care, homemaker services, home delivered meals, and chore services, including laundry service. Services can be requested individually or combined. Can provide limited home bathroom modifications for safety. Does not include skilled nursing services. When program is full, assists those on waiting list to find needed services in the community. Chore services and limited bathroom modifications cannot be assessed without using other services.

Application process

Phone for application information and telephone screening. Following this, there will be an in-home assessment for applicant. Client can apply for a single service if desired, but they will be advised if they may also be eligible for other assistance if they choose. NOTE: Extremely long waiting list, basically, as someone comes off the program the agency will then let an applicant enter program (1 out, 1 in.) There may be periods when the agency is not accepting applications for particular services through the program.

Fee

There is a co-pay for this program; clients pay a percentage of the services they receive. That percentage is based on the participant's income.

Eligibility

Open to frail elderly age 60 or older, or those 18 through 59 with a documented disability who are living in a private home or apartment in Cuyahoga County (excludes group homes, assisted living residences, and nursing homes) and are not eligible for any Medicaid waiver program. Eligibility is also based on an assessment of need for activities of daily living assistance such as bathing, dressing, meal preparation, housekeeping etc.. Participants must be below 300% of the federal poverty level.
